YGA, Devialet, Bryston, PS Audio, Kubala-Sosna

In a much smaller room next door to GTT Audio's main suite, YG Acoustics’ Carmel loudspeakers ($18,000/pair) were driven by a Devialet D-Premier integrated amplifier/DAC ($16,999). Source components were Bryston’s BDP-1 digital media player ($2250) and PS Audio’s Perfect Wave Transport ($3000). Cables were Kubala-Sosna’s Emotion.

Again, I listened to “Watershed” from Mark Hollis, and, again, I was impressed by the overall scale—just as well-balanced as in the larger GTT Audio room, but only appropriately smaller. Tonal qualities were similar to those found in the larger room, and there were similar senses of dynamic ease and control, power, delicacy, and detail.
